Spurred by Earthjustice, EPA Issues Limits for Deadly Soot

June 15, 2012, earthjustice.org | “Just two weeks ago, the Environmental Protection Agency was dithering on a proposal to strengthen protections against an air pollutant that causes tens of thousands of avoidable deaths every year.  Enter Earthjustice attorney, Paul Cort, who on behalf of citizen groups asked a federal judge to order the EPA to get moving.”
